How much do oracle data entry j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 13, 2026, the average hourly pay for oracle data entry in Indiana is $18.53,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$15.58 and $20.82 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is an Oracle data entry?

An Oracle Data Entry job involves inputting, updating, and managing data within Oracle databases or applications. Professionals in this role ensure accurate data entry, maintain records, and verify information to support business operations. They may also generate reports, troubleshoot minor database issues, and follow company data management procedures. Strong attention to detail and familiarity with Oracle software are essential for success in this role.

What does an Oracle data entry do?

As an Oracle Data Entry specialist, your daily tasks usually include entering, updating, and verifying large volumes of data in Oracle databases, ensuring accuracy and compliance with company standards. You may also be responsible for identifying and correcting data discrepancies, generating basic reports, and collaborating with IT or business teams to support data-driven operations. In many organizations, you work alongside data analysts, managers, or system administrators, which helps you learn more about data management and potentially advance into more technical roles over time. The work environment can range from office-based settings to remote work, depending on the employer's needs.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the Oracle data entry position?

To excel as an Oracle Data Entry professional, you need strong attention to detail, accurate typing skills, and a foundational understanding of database concepts, often backed by a high school diploma or equivalent. Familiarity with Oracle Database environments, data entry software, and sometimes certifications like Oracle Database SQL Certified Associate are highly beneficial. Outstanding organization, time management, and communication skills set top performers apart in this role. These abilities ensure data integrity, minimize errors, and support efficient workflow in database-driven organizations.

About Herff Jones:

Indianapolis-based Herff Jones is the leading provider of graduation and educational products and services designed to inspire achievement and create memorable experiences for students. Herff Jonesโ€™ products include class rings and jewelry, caps and gowns, diplomas and announcements as well as motivation and recognition programs. Focused on building long-term relationships through a nationwide network of over 1,400 employees and sales partners, the professionals at Herff Jones have been helping elevate the student experience throughout the lifelong journey of education for more than 100 years. Your Opportunity:ย 

Theย Order Entryย NameListย Associateย is an important part of the team supportingย high schools,ย collegesย and other educational institutions (ourย customers).ย As a member of theย Orderย Entryย sub-team, you willย be responsible forย dailyย review of orders from customersย andย Herff Jonesย Independentย Salesย Partners (ISPs); these orders areย delivered through ourย web-basedย ESKOย portal.ย Preparing orders withย accurateย information to prevent changes is aย critically importantย function of this role, so attention to detail is crucial.ย Data entryย OF THE Name Listย is the firstย stepย of manyย inย ensuringย high-qualityย productsย goย timelyย fromย our manufacturing environmentย toย our customers.ย
